SBS Language | Australia and India are 'natural partners', says Prime Minister Scott Morrison at Raisina Dialogue


Share on Twitter
On the second-last day of the Raisina Dialogue, India’s premier summit on geopolitics, Australia’s Prime Minister Scott welcomed India’s “increasingly active role” in the Indo-Pacific region, especially in the distribution of the coronavirus vaccine.
“We welcome your leadership PM Modi, we welcome India’s leadership and engagement, whether it’s on the outstanding vaccines that are necessary and the ‘Maitree’ campaign that you have engaged in, which has seen over 64 million Indian-made vaccines shipped to more than 80 countries,” Mr Morrison said.

Punjab National Bank : UK approves diamond tycoon Nirav Modi's extradition to India

LONDON (Reuters) - Britain has approved the extradition of fugitive Indian diamond tycoon Nirav Modi, a Home Office spokesman said on Friday.
The jeweller fled India before details on his alleged involvement in $2.2 billion bank fraud, India s biggest, became public in 2018. The fraud dented confidence in the state banking sector and New Delhi has since tried to get Modi extradited.
On 25 February the District Judge gave judgment in the extradition case of Nirav Modi. The extradition order was signed on April 15, a spokesman for the United Kingdom s Home Office said in a statement on Friday.
Modi, whose diamonds have adorned Hollywood stars such as Kate Winslet and Dakota Johnson, can still appeal to a higher court in Britain against the decisions of both the district court and the secretary within 14 days. ....
